## Deploying the Gatewick Proctor Queue

Deploys are pretty painless: push to main, wait for the pipeline, then watch the queue drain dashboard for five minutes. If candidates pile up mid-exam, roll back first and ask questions later — the queue replays safely. Everything the workers care about lives in one config block, shown here for reference.

settings of bafof-yagef:
JOROX_PIN=8740
JOROX_TENANT=pelox
JOROX_METRICS_HOST=metrics.jorox.qorvelworks.internal
JOROX_SEAL=seal_c78f63c1
JOROX_STANDBY_TEAM=norax

## Deployment Notes: Export Format v5

This release changes the Medlock payroll export from fixed-width records to the delimited v5 layout required by our downstream processor. Reviewers should confirm that the feature flag gating the new writer defaults to off, and that the legacy writer remains untouched for tenants still on v4. Pay particular attention to the column-mapping logic, since misalignment there silently corrupts pay amounts. The deployment relies on the configuration values given below.

deployment values, yadug-bawif:
[framir]
team = pelox
access_code = ac_a38ab2
owner = tamion.julael
host = framir.tolvaqlabs.test
port = 11211
peer = tammir.zemvargrid.local
salt = 2215ef03
pin = 1541

Hey Marta,

Handing off the trace-propagation work on Lanternpath. The span context now survives the hop between the cart and pricing services — the fix was threading the baggage header through the async queue consumer. Please double-check the sampling decision isn't re-rolled downstream; that bit me twice. Tests are green but eyeball the integration suite anyway. The design notes and open questions are written up here.

operations page: https://jira.lumiclabs.internal/pages/display/projects/af69ce92

## Supplier Contract Renewal — Grelling Logistics (Managers Only)

Heads up, branch managers: the Grelling Logistics contract comes up for renewal at quarter-end, and we're pushing for better delivery windows this time around. Rates will likely tick up 4%, but we're bundling the cold-chain routes to offset it. Don't commit to new delivery promises with customers until terms are locked. The confidential note on the bigger-picture plans is below.

internal memo for hahaf-kahof: Only 39 of the 428 pilot accounts renewed Sorion, so a churn review is set for April 12. Praokix Freight is in early talks to buy Queniusox Group for about $145.8 million.